S&P downgrades Sarens

S&P said it lowered its long-term issuer credit ratings on Sarens Bestuur NV and Sarens Finance Co. NV to B+ from BB-.

The outlook is negative.

At the same time, the agency affirmed the issue rating on the group's €250 million senior unsecured debt issued by Sarens Finance at BB-.

S&P said that although it calculates recovery prospects comfortably above 85%, it caps the recovery rating at 2, reflecting the unsecured nature of the notes.

The agency said the downgrade reflects revised expectations for Sarens for fiscal-year 2018.

“The group continues to experience challenging conditions in some of its end markets, coupled with higher-than-expected subcontracting costs,” S&P said in a news release.
